Output 64680c3e2bb5e66fbd185e1d564deb941c3e674f801c7468052579a4e815d8fb:80

value
81558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1d815a3501e952ec078e2d170ecae9811da4e5 OP_EQUAL
address
3MrAc12VE1ykXDxus5LsoVYmbaKb21cehj
transaction
64680c3e2bb5e66fbd185e1d564deb941c3e674f801c7468052579a4e815d8fb
spent
true